Oct. 30, 2009

OXFORD, Ohio – The Miami field hockey team heads to Kent, Ohio this Saturday to take on conference rival and fellow MAC championship contender Kent State at 11 a.m. Miami will then travel to Athens, Ohio to take on the Bobcats of Ohio University on Sunday at 1 p.m.

The RedHawks are currently 10-8-0 overall and are second in the MAC at 6-2-0, while the Golden Flashes sit just above at 11-6-0 overall and 7-1-0 in conference action. Ohio is currently third at 8-8-0 overall, while matching Miami at 6-2-0 in conference action.

Miami is fresh off yet another conference win this past Sunday at Missouri State as the RedHawks downed the Bears, 2-1, in overtime. Junior Christine Brightwell scored the game-winner for Miami as she sunk a shot under four minutes in to overtime against the Bears. The RedHawks are currently led by senior forward Mary Hull who has 11 goals, three assists and 25 points on the season.

Kent State is looking to nab its second-straight MAC title. The Flashes are coming off a 5-2 conference win over Central Michigan last Saturday. Sophomore Debbie Bell leads Kent State and currently ranks fourth in the country with 22 goals scored. She now has six game-winning goals this season and is tied for the sixth most in a single season at KSU.

Ohio is also coming off of a conference win in this last stretch that is shaping up to be a fight to the finish. The Bobcats overwhelmed CMU last weekend, 5-0, a game in which Ohio’s Marcy Dull scored a hat trick. The team is currently led by junior Katharine Ballard who is tied for most goals on the season with eight, and leads in shots, shots on goal and game winning goals with 54, 36 and four respectively.

This weekend, the last in the regular season, will determine the final rankings heading into the MAC Tournament that begins next Thursday, Nov. 5 in Muncie, Ind. with the quarterfinal round. The semifinals will take place on Friday, Nov. 6 and the championship game will be on Saturday, Nov. 7. Times for each match are to be announced.
